Fees and Costs of Registered Agent Solutions

The expenses associated with designated representative solutions can change significantly based on multiple considerations. In general, organizations can forecast to spend anywhere $100 to $500 per year for a reputable designated agent. Factors influencing these costs include the complexity of services provided, the company's reputation, and the physical region. Essential services typically cover the basics, such as handling legal documents and compliance alerts. Nonetheless, some companies offer additional options, such as business mail handling or electronic document delivery, which can alter the entire cost.

Every limited liability company and corporation must designate a designated agent to handle legal documents on behalf the business. The designated agent acts as the official point of contact for service of process and other important communications. States typically require that the registered agent be a citizen of the state in which the business operates or a company authorized to do business in that state. These regulations ensure that there is a reliable person or entity available for legal communication.

To fulfill designated agent requirements, the individual or entity must have a real address within the state, which is often referred to as the registered office. This location cannot be a postal box. Furthermore, the designated agent must be accessible during standard working hours to accept and sign for official papers. Maintaining reliable availability is essential, as overlooked communications can lead to default judgments or legal complications.

Every state has specific registered agent regulations, including the need for an agent to have a legitimate contract filed with the Secretary of State's agency. It is important for businesses to ensure that their designated agent is compliant with state laws and regulations to avoid issues with service of process and to maintain legal standing for the business entity.

Another significant benefit is the confidentiality and professionalism that a registered agent provides. By appointing a registered agent, business owners can preserve their privacy, as the agent’s address is recorded with the state instead of the owner’s personal address. This can be especially helpful for beneficial for home-based businesses or small startups looking to safeguard their personal information while presenting a professional image to clients and partners.
